Purpose Banana peels account for around 30-40% of the banana's weight and represent an industrial waste. This biomass can be used as an eco-friendly solution for biotechnological bioprocesses. Still, due to the fibrous nature of banana peels, pretreatment becomes essential to enhance the effectiveness of enzymes on the hydrolysis of complex carbohydrates. Sternal bursitis is an underexplored lesion in poultry, often overlooked in microbiological diagnostics. In this study, we characterized 36 Escherichia coli isolates recovered from sternal bursitis in broiler chickens, combining phenotypic antimicrobial susceptibility testing, PCR-based screening, and whole genome sequencing (WGS).
